Consider a HUD House

The Department of Urban and Housing Development sells its authorities foreclosures, identified as HUD houses, at prices that are discounted. Borrowers with less than perfect credit can possibly qualify to buy a HUD house through home mortgages insured by the Government’s Federal Housing Administration. Conventional mortgage plans frequently need higher down payments and closing prices than the HUD plan, even if you have high credit ratings, notes “U.S. Information and Planet Report.” Mortgage downpayments range from 3.5% (credit score of 580 and greater) to one-tenth (credit rating below 580), even for these customers with credit scores in the 500s. Hurricane survivors instructors and emergency services staff also possibly qualify for reductions of up to 50 per cent off the cost. Nevertheless, remember that all HUD houses are offered as is, some attributes and ” might need substantial repairs “.

Get a Cosigner

Not all mortgage brokers approve cosigners, but if you’re able to get one, this measure can go quite a distance toward obtaining you in to that first house, notes Loan.com. In some instances, financing and your cosigner’s credit can allow you to meet the requirements for a mortgage that is higher than you could by yourself. Nevertheless, some mortgage brokers, including these playing FHA-insured plans, require co signers to be connected by blood or relationship. You as well as your cosigner must realize that equally of your credit are at danger if for reasons uknown you CAn’t as assured pay the mortgage. But in case your credit after enhances, perhaps you are able enough take away the cosigner from your mortgage and to re finance the loan.
